Welcome to crime data report for Kulm, North Dakota, an area with a population of 490 residents. In this data exploration, we will delve into the crime statistics of Kulm, North Dakota shedding light on its safety and security. The closest law enforcement agency from Kulm is Lamoure County Sheriff's Office (ND0230000) approximately around 31.12 miles away from the center of Kulm.

This analysis uses the latest crime data submitted by Lamoure County Sheriff's Office to the FBI National Incident-Based Reporting System (NIBRS).

Note: In area with small number of population such as Kulm, the data might be skewed in infrequent crimes such as homicide, rape, and arson.
